Price Volatility
Extreme weather conditions Economic conditions
What causes price volatility? Availability of supply
Bridge Power Consultants aim to educate the consumers about market conditions, pricing impacts
and the important factor of “Price Volatility” : The following factors impact supply and demand and
contribute to price volatility:
Extreme hot or cold temperatures will increase energy
demand, driving costs up. Likewise, extreme weather
conditions such as hurricanes can disrupt supply
and also elevate costs.
Energy prices fluctuate based on changes in supply
and demand.When energy supply increases, prices tend
to go down and when there is a shortage, prices go up.
When demand for energy increases, prices increase and
when it decreases, prices tend to fall.
Growing economies with increased infrastructure
demands drive up energy demand and costs. Poorly
performing economies often result in reduced demand
and lower costs.
The majority of the energy we use is generated from fossil fuels such
as coal and natural gas. This is generally the cheapest form of energy
generation. When there is a shortageof these fossil fuels, other more
expensive forms of energy generation will need to be used resulting in
higher energy prices.
How do different energy products help
control price volatility?
What doe-s the market look like today?
Variable rate
Fixed rate plans
Mirror market rates. As such, customers
on these plans are exposed to market
price volatility. A variable rate plan is
ideal when rates are relatively stable
or expected to decrease.
Offer customers a set rate for their commodity
supply over a period of time. These plans
provide protection from market price
volatility as your rate is fixed and not
affected by changes in commodity
prices.

Why is Deregulation Important?
Deregulation gives consumers choice
What does this mean for Customers?
Will my service be disrupted?
The power of the buyer. A deregulated market
allows you to choose your commodity supplier.
It also motivates retailers to differentiate their
products from the utility and those of competitors
by developing innovative features, pricing plans
and options that would have otherwise not been
available to you. In deregulated electricity markets,
these products support the generation and injection
of renewable energy into your electricity grid, making
it greener than it otherwise would have been.
The utility is still responsible for the distribution of
the commodity to your home regardless of the
supplier you choose. The supply price however is
not set by that same utility. Depending on where
you live, you may continue to be billed by your utility
with a mention of your supplier, or be billed directly
by your supplier.
Although your natural gas and/or electricity supply
will be coming from a new source, your local utility/
distribution company will continue to ensure the
consistent delivery of the energy to your business.

Energy Customers : Usage Profile
Usage depends on customer type/Industry
Usage varies based on weather and demand
characteristics
Usage varies based on weather and demand
characteristics
Type Usage per Year
General Store 470,400.00
Churchs / Congregations 164,720.00
Data Center 20,534,490.00
Dry Cleaners 61,750.00
Grocery 1,313,400.00
Health Care Urgent Care/ Docto 540,000.00
Hospitals 20,450,000.00
Hotals /Motels 662,300.00
Lite Manufacturing 1,787,400.00
Computer Manufacturing 5,553,448.00
Machine 2,149,007.00
Printing 1,254,266.00
Furniture 908,691.00
Small Office building 470,400.00
Resturants 327,000.00
Small Retail 167,810.00
Large Retail 550,620.00
Schools 584,200.00
Warehouse 132,300.00
Referigated warehouse 562,819.00
Expected Energy Usage Per Year
